We love fashion projects that let kids show off their own unique style, and this awesome notebook t-shirt idea from crafty mama Desirée Campbell at The 36th Avenue is the perfect example. With just a few simple, inexpensive materials, Desirée was able to create a super cute back-to-school tee for her daughter, Anni (pictured left). We love that it looks like a page from a lined notebook, which makes it ideal for doodling on and letting kids customize it to suit their tastes. Talk about one-of-a-kind!

Because there are no glue guns or sewing machines involved, this is an ideal project for kids of all ages. In fact, we think it would make a great activity for a birthday or sleepover party—just break out the Sharpies and let kids go wild!

What you’ll need:
• Plain white t-shirt
• Coloured permanent markers (eg. Sharpies)
• Ruler
• Piece of cardboard
• Stencil
